The Ottawa area has yet another lottery winner, this time $11.5 million in the Lotto 6/49 draw.

The Ontario Lottery and Gaming Corporation said Monday the winning ticket from Saturday's draw was bought in the Ottawa region.

There is no information on the identity of the winner or winners yet.

This win comes after a number of lottery wins in recent months, including a $50 Lotto Max million win by a Hawkesbury couple in January.

Gaetan and Jo-Ann Champagne will officially claim their winnings on Wednesday after an investigation by the OLG because the couple previously owned a convenience store.

Ten people in Aylmer, Que. won $16.6 million as part of another $50 million Lotto Max jackpot in early February, while a Brockville couple won $15 million just days later from the same lottery.
